numbles
Meaning
The entrails of a deer or other animal, used for food.
Etymology
From Middle French nombles (“loin of meat”), alteration (with dissimilation) of Old French and Anglo-Norman lumbles (“loins”), from Latin lumbulus, diminutive of lumbus (“loin”).
